Why RBI Cancels NBFC Registration?
The Reserve Bank of India (RBI) may cancel an NBFC’s Certificate of Registration (CoR) under Section 45-IA(6) of the RBI Act, 1934 for reasons such as:
Failing to conduct NBFC business within six months of registration
Non-compliance with RBI guidelines or prudential norms
Failure to maintain Net Owned Funds (NOF) above ₹2 crores
Engaging in activities that violate public interest or financial laws
Non-submission of statutory returns or audit reports
